Explanation:
All direct variation equations are of the form y = kx, for some constant k.
We know that y = -8 and x = 4 pair up together. Let's use these two values to find k
y = kx
-8 = k*4
-8/4 = k
-2 = k
k = -2
Therefore, we go from y = kx to y = -2x
We can then find y when x = -4
y = -2x
y = -2*(-4)
y = 8
